Pricing Strategies Used By Dealers For Boat Sales
It is indeed important to know how most boat dealers price their units for their boat sales, especially when you plan to buy one or sell your existing boats. You should know the standard prices for various brands and models available in the market today.
The market for boating is extremely competitive, so it should be easy for you to find some good dealers both online and in physical docks. Price list for new and used boats are pretty much standard, thus prices from various dealers will be most likely closer to each other. By knowing the standard prices, you can easily identify which dealers are pricing you right and which are overpricing.
You may find one dealer to be selling units in a very low price, while others choose to price their boats higher. Whether you're buying or selling boat, it is very important to be aware of the price listings of various brands and models and the factors that influences its price and resale value.
There are many trusted names that provide good and free appraisal of used boat's value, these appraisal guides are from BUC, NADA, and ABOS. You can also check online for free and up-to-date appraisal guides. These stuff can be really helpful in giving you an estimate price based on boat's price, manufacturer, model and add-on features. Aside from upgrades and elective features of new and used boats, geographical location can add-up to the watercraft's price.
Upgrades for the boat such as satellite or radar systems, engine parts, electronic packages, newly installed cockpit carpet, dinghy lifts, installed canvass tops, etc. If the upgrades were done for maintenance, then the used boat will most likely be sold in higher price.
These appraisal guides will help you assess not just the boat's price, but even the accessories and installations mounted on the watercraft. Boats from all types like personal watercraft, power boats, sail boats, boat trailers, pontoon boats, and outboard motors.

Finding The Best Used Trucks For Your Business
Delivery of products and goods is a very important part of physical business, as it allows you to deliver your products right at your retailer's and wholesaler's doorsteps. Most starting businessmen have second thoughts in purchasing used trucks, as they are most likely word and used-up by its previous owners for its business. But the truth is, you can always find a good buy by scrutinizing the available options within your budget range. If you're into small business and you have to deliver your products from places to places, then buying used trucks would be the best option for your business.
There are many truck dealers that sells both brand new and used trucks from various brands and models, and you can easily find some great deals by visiting these dealers. You can find these dealers online and near your town. However, before you jump into their garage, it would be wise if you do your homework and research in advance for the trucks you want to acquire.
Prominent brands for trucks such as Isuzu, Mazda, Mercedes Benz, Freight Liner, Volvo, Mitsubishi, Hino and Toyota should be at the top of your list. These brands of trucks can accommodate various needs from light duty, medium duty and heavy duty tucking needs. Many dealers also sell various forms of trucks like fire trucks, tow trucks, dump trucks, pickup trucks, etc. By carefully choosing what you need, you can boost up the potential of your delivery. The following are more tips you have to consider when choosing a used truck.
Trucks used for not more than 3-4 years is a good buy, but of course, you should consider how the truck was used, what is usually transport and how often it was used by its previous owner.
Determining your budget line can also help you narrow your options from brands and models of trucks.
Also, when you're talking with the dealer personally, it would really help you understand the condition and prices of your prospective units by looking at the used truck's blue book. Always compare the prices based on the car's brand, condition and years of used, as this truck would be your main arsenal for the delivery of your products.
Before finalizing everything with your dealer, make sure you arrange all important documents to avoid compromises. Also, dealers may offer you high and expensive prices, but you can always lower it down. Never forget that dealers will look for ways to sell those units, so price it properly.
